  • Title

    A novel optoelectronic sampling technique by using a delay-time tunable ultrafast laser diode

  • Abstract
    We demonstrate a DC-voltage controlled optoelectronic delay-line for continuous tuning the relative delay-time of optical pulse-train generated from gain-switched laser diode. The maximum tuning delay-time can be up to 3.9 ns for pulses repeated at 500 MHz. Electro-optic sampling of high-frequency microwave signal by using the modified pulsed laser as novel optical source is reported
